We are seeking a substantive Consultant Clinical Oncologist specialising in Breast cancers to join our team at University Hospital Southampton. This is a full time (10.25 PAs) post with less than full-time options available.

You will work alongside the established breast cancer Clinical Oncology consultant and multidisciplinary team to provide radiotherapy +/- SACT services as part of a busy and dynamic department. ÌýA second disease site alongside breast cancer is outlined in the job description as skin cancer; other tumour sites combined with breast cancer will be considered and applicants are encouraged to make contact to discuss options.

The cancer centre provides comprehensive services to a large local and regional population, with seven linear accelerators providing radiotherapy services including SABR and SRS. Image-guided and surface-guided radiotherapy are implemented across all treatment units.

This post will be clinically responsible for the care of patients with breast cancer within UHS and across the wider region. ÌýThe successful candidate with suitable training and enthusiasm would also have the opportunity to join the oligometastatic SABR service. ÌýDuties will include:

• Ìý ÌýAttending the weekly UHS Breast MDT and clinics
• Ìý ÌýPlanning and supervising radiotherapy for Breast cancer patients
• Ìý ÌýPlanning and supervising Systemic Anti Cancer Therapy for Breast cancer patients
• Ìý ÌýEngaging in Radiotherapy Peer review meetings
• Ìý ÌýTeaching and training specialist trainees in Clinical Oncology and the wider multidisciplinary team
• Ìý ÌýActively engaging in the management of, recruitment in to and running of clinical trials

A second subspecialist disease site of skin cancer is described in the job description. Applicants who wish to consider alternative second subspecialist disease sites are encouraged to apply and make contact for further discussions. ÌýThe skin cancer elements of the post will support the existing team at UHS and across the wider region, including provision of radiotherapy for melanoma patients and radiotherapy and SACT for non-melanoma skin cancers. Ìý

The role includes participation in an on call rota for the management of Clinical Oncology patients out of hours, providing advice during evenings and undertaking daily ward rounds during weekends and Bank Holidays (1:20)
